Output 2c8637eb031162f72acf21c97f779ff1db34fbe0257de946c8182654381a35b2:91

value
388882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2fba43a805bb6ed9a3aabc6e0fb50a3017a1d9 OP_EQUAL
address
34MLhH6L5516gMQ9wCcVQdjjSDkbiRXvQa
transaction
2c8637eb031162f72acf21c97f779ff1db34fbe0257de946c8182654381a35b2
spent
true